row and cell index problem
why row index is undefined ??????????????
Code:
function ci(x){
var a = x.cellIndex;
var b = x.rowIndex;
document.getElementById("ci").innerHTML = a+" x "+b;
}
HTML Code:
<table border="2" id="tablo1">
<th>P.tesi</th>
<th>Salı</th>
<th>Çarşamba</th>
<th>Perşembe</th>
<th>Cuma</th>
<th>C.tesi</th>
<th>Pazar</th>
<tr onclick="ci(this)">
<td onclick="ci(this)">26</td>
<td onclick="ci(this)">27</td>
<td onclick="ci(this)">28</td>
<td onclick="ci(this)">29</td>
<td onclick="ci(this)">30</td>
<td onclick="ci(this)">1</td>
<td onclick="ci(this)">2</td>
</tr>
<tr onclick="ci(this)">
<td onclick="ci(this)">2</td>
<td onclick="ci(this)">3</td>
<td onclick="ci(this)">13</td>
<td onclick="ci(this)"> </td>
<td onclick="ci(this)"> </td>
<td onclick="ci(this)"> </td>
<td onclick="ci(this)"> </td>
</tr>
<tr onclick="ci(this)">
<td onclick="ci(this)">9</td>
<td onclick="ci(this)">10</td>
<td onclick="ci(this)">11</td>
<td onclick="ci(this)">12</td>
<td onclick="ci(this)">13</td>
<td onclick="ci(this)">14</td>
<td onclick="ci(this)">15</td>
</tr>
<tr onclick="ci(this)">
<td onclick="ci(this)">16</td>
<td onclick="ci(this)">17</td>
<td onclick="ci(this)">20</td>
<td onclick="ci(this)"> </td>
<td onclick="ci(this)"> </td>
<td onclick="ci(this)">21</td>
<td onclick="ci(this)">22</td>
</tr>
<tr onclick="ci(this)">
<td onclick="ci(this)">23</td>
<td onclick="ci(this)">24</td>
<td onclick="ci(this)">25</td>
<td onclick="ci(this)">26</td>
<td onclick="ci(this)">27</td>
<td onclick="ci(this)">28</td>
<td onclick="ci(this)">29</td>
</tr>
<tr>
<td colspan="5"><div>index :</div></td>
<td colspan="2"><b><div id="ci"></div></b></td>
</tr>
</table>
http://divran.com/s/upload/images/jx...0sy8_thumb.gif